    Transponder key programming

    The majority of modern cars come with a transponder chip which acts as the key fob and assists to deter theft of cars. This small chip is located in the head of your key and transmits an indication when you insert it. The signal will then allow the car to begin. They are more reliable than traditional keys and are a great option to shield your vehicle from thieves. However, they are not 100% foolproof and may experience issues from time to time. There are solutions to the issue. If you're experiencing problems with your transponder keys the best thing you can do is to call an automotive locksmith.

    nearest auto locksmith locksmiths can assist with car lockouts, and can replace a key fob that has been stolen or lost. They can also assist you to program a new key or rekey the existing one. To do this, they employ a specific software designed to read and modify your car's code. This process is known as "transponder programming." It is crucial to know that this is not an easy task and it requires a great deal of technical expertise.

    Fobs

    Fobs are a great way to unlock your home, office, or car without having to turn a key. They work using radio frequencies to communicate with an electronic device called a remote reader which in turn activates the lock mechanism. Fobs are usually small enough to fit on a keychain, and can be easily reprogrammed if needed. However, they do not provide the same level security as the traditional keys. Fobs are vulnerable to attacks like relay attacks, which allow thieves to steal signals and gain entry.

    Apartment key fobs provide an easy method to enter apartments. They are small, circular pieces that can be slipped on to your keychain to unlock doors by tapping the sensor. When the fob is tapped against the sensor, it emits a certain frequency. If the frequency is in line with the one programmed into system of the apartment complex the door will be opened. Fobs are also popular for offices, as they can be used to regulate access to elevators and individual rooms.

    Key fobs for apartments aren't powered by batteries, like physical keys. They draw power from the magnetic energy transferred between the fob and the remote reader device. This method of operation makes them more efficient than batteries which will need to be replaced regularly.
